As far as I know Il2 series included officially a significant amount of 3rd party projects (3D objects, maps) long before the modding started. Even a plethora of 3rd party programs was welcomed (HL, DCG, MAT manager...). How is that fighting people that create content for the game? DT hasn't changed that policy.
I never saw any official welcome. And I'm sure no financial support either.

1. HL (Hyperlobby), was there before IL2 Stumo v1.0 and was picked up by IL2 users because the UBI servers were useless and ended up dysfunctional almost from day 1 of IL2.

2. Lowengrin's DCG from CFS series was before IL2 v1.0 and developed for IL2. After Starshoy stopped supporting and developing IL2's Ngen and Dgen, Lowengrin filled a gap desperately needed from stock unsupported DCG.

3. Mat Manager was initially a useful program to make the default aircraftmarking look reasonable and enable the Swastika/Hakenkreuz.
it later developed into a bigger program for tweaking the games settings.

So none of these are included as content that required the SFS to be altered just programs that filled the slow failings of IL2 as it evolved and become full of bugs and out of date unsupported code.
